Our Favorite Vanilla Cake

I found this recipe back in 2003 when we first began the gluten-free cooking and baking journey. It was a keeper for countless years! The go to recipe when we needed a reliable cake recipe. Preheat oven 350°
 
Ingredients:
 
1 tsp xanthan gum
¾ cup brown rice flour
¼ cup almond flour
¼ cup tiger nut flour
¼ sweet sorghum flour
¾ cup tapioca flour
1 tsp baking soda
3 tsp baking powder
1 tsp salt
½ cup warm water
2/3 cups mayo (olive oil mayo)
1 cup almond milk
4 eggs (room temp)
1 ¼ cups sugar
 
Directions:
  1. In (2) 8” cake rounds or (3) 6” cake rounds, grease and tap with flour, discarding the excess flour
  2. Shift together the dry ingredients (first 9 ingredients)
  3. In a separate bowl cream together the sugar and mayo
  4. Add the vanilla to the sugar mixture, mix.
  5. Slowly add the sugar mixture to the dry ingredients, alternating with the milk.
  6. Add the water to the mixture. Mix
  7. Next add one egg at a time. Mix a little bit in between.
  8. Scrape the sides of the bowl to insure all the ingredients are well combined
  9. Place in either 6” cake pan- bake for 38-40 minutes OR 8” cake pan bake for 25-30 minutes.
  10.  Frost with a lemon almond mixed buttercream
